Took the SCAR 17 (.308 WIN) out today to check the scope @ 100 yards.
My first round jammed and look what happened. The next 59 rounds cycled just fine. I was using the Winchester 147gr FMJ White Box ammo and I've read it has had some problems. The Range Officer freaked out kinda. He said he's never seen not only the round bottleneck flatten out but also lip over on the side. Not sure you can tell from the pic but it's really Fluked up.
I wonder if there was an obstruction of some kind or the bolt carrier jammed it inside the receiver? Either way it worked like a charm after. Every shot hit the paper including the foul.
